17.01.2019
News
Two GIS trainings City of Brno and mobility stakeholders were held on the 17th and 21st of January 2019. The aim of these trainings was to introduce and demonstrate how to use the SUMP Monitoring Tool which is an app developed by City of Brno, and is their main output for the LOW-CARB project. 13.11.2018
News snippet
In July, Parma’s TEP brought the first Chinese-manufactured e-bus to EU roads to test its energy consumption & recharging times under different conditions (empty, with air-conditioning, etc). During the EU MOBILITY WEEK , Parma’s citizens were invited to share their experiences and views. The results of the Line 8 tests, which connects the city’s eastern suburbs, are already feeding into an action plan for PT e-services and multipurpose charging infrastructure (expected completion: May 2020).
The end result? Seamless multi-modal local zero-emission mobility in Parma!

22.06.2017
News snippet
June 21st, the European summer solstice, marked the launch of LOW-CARB. Project Partners were hosted by Leipziger Verkehrsbetriebe in the hometown of the lead partner, and besides running through the project’s key outputs, they enjoyed a city site visit via the city’s new ‘XL’ tram.
LOW-CARB puts the organisation of low-carbon public transport at the forefront of reducing GHG emissions, combined with new mobility offers like bike-sharing (supported by solar-powered e-bike charging stations), public transport e-feeder service) or multimodal information services (incl. MaaS) to encourage shared mobility.
